About the Role

As a CQC Registered Manager you will be responsible for one of our registered services, Errol House in Boston Spa. You will have a team of Managers and Assistant Managers to support you to ensure best practice is promoted and implemented.

At Errol House we have 5 individuals living with us, who all need support due to their varying conditions (cerebral palsy, autism and learning disabilities). None of these however limit their outlook on life. Everyone has an amazing and mischievous sense of humour and love nothing more than joking around. You can expect your working day at Errol House to be fun, full of activities and endless laughs!

All the individuals living here are non-verbal and require 1:1 support with aspects of 2:1 support when they access the community. 3 of the individuals are also wheelchair users so the use of hoists and manual handling will occur throughout the service.
